The 1K0820803E AC Compressor Control Solenoid Valve is a direct-fit replacement for Sanden PXE16 and PXE14 compressors used in select Volkswagen and Audi models from 2006-2015. Featuring a snap ring mounting system for quick installation, it offers reliable compressor pressure regulation backed by a 12-month warranty and rigorous quality testing. Compatible with numerous OEM part numbers, this valve ensures seamless integration and long-lasting performance for your vehicle’s climate control system.

It fit 2013 VW Golf TDI
I am fortunate in that a buddy has a lift that we used. We had the old solenoid out and the new one installed in less than 15 minutes. This could not happen WITHOUT THE LIFT! Without a lift this job would be a real pain. You have the plastic skid plate to remove to access the area of the AC Compressor. Since we could stand under vehicle the angles to get into the location, especially with the snap ring pliers was very easy. if this was laying on your back under car ramps it would be very difficult. My advice: if you need the part, and its easy to determine if you do ( watch videos on line) buy the part and see if a local mechanic will install for $30-$40. FYI couldn't find part locally, unless dealer which was outrages in price. One other thing: I am sure that unscrupulous mechanics will tell you to replace the compressor etc. NOT NEEDED...save yourself $100'sUpdate 6/4 /19: The AC is running great -ice cold! In fact Ithink its colder now than when the vehicle was new! I am changing my overall rating to 5 stars. I hope the part lasts!Also, I would strongly encourage changing your serpentine belt if your replacing this solenoid. Why? its very easy to get to from under the vehicle, while doing this solenoid. The belt is relatively cheap $12-$15. One socket on the "tensioner" and it was off and a new installed in under 3 minutes!

Fixed A/C issue for my 2012 Volkswagen Jetta S.E
After replacing my compressor and condenser (thinking that was the issue, money wasted) my air still wouldn’t blow cold, nothing but hot air. As soon as I ordered this piece and had it put on, added a 1/2 can of Freon my air blows so cold I have to run it on a low setting. So glad I purchased from Amazon. This same piece was $180 at Autozone then dropped to $112. Nope!!!!
